Congratulations to Noel Ovenden and Winston Michael were both re-elected in their Wards.
Wye
| CHILTON, Jayne | Labour Party | 142 |
| DOVE, Stuart James | Liberal Democrats – Stronger Economy Fairer Society | 71 |
| HOWARD, Alex | The Conservative Party Candidate | 402 |
| NEWILL, Alan William Edward | UK Independence Party (UKIP) | 126 |
| OVENDEN, Noel | Ashford Independent | 651 (E) |
| Turnout: 74.91% |
Boughton Aluph & Eastwell
| BUNN, Len | The Conservative Party Candidate | 465 |
| MICHAEL, Winston Russel | Ashford Independent | 895 (E) |
| MICKLEWRIGHT, Len | Liberal Democrats – Stronger Economy Fairer Society | 64 |
| BULLEY, Ryan | Labour Party | 158 |
| Turnout: 65.52% |
Following the Election Independent Cllr David Smith (South Willesborough) having shown interest was invited to join the Ashford Independents, bringing the Councillor group to three.
Ex-Cllr Peter Davison has resigned from the position of Party Leader and becomes Chairman of the Ashford Independent Association. Ex-Cllr and past Mayor Mrs Palma Laughton MBE becomes President of the AIA following the retirement of Mrs Betty Turner, wife of ex-Cllr and past Mayor Gordon Turner.
